Web15 sep. 2024 · Overhead is defined as a “percentage of a charity’s expenses that goes to administrative and fundraising costs” (Guidestar, 2014). The Overhead Myth is created when donors believe that nonprofits should keep these overhead expenses below a certain percentage of the nonprofit’s total expenditures – usually no more than 15 to 20 percent. Web14 jan. 2024 · How the Head of a Jazz Nonprofit Spends Her Sundays 151ViewsbyThe New York TimesJanuary 14, 2024, 12:00 pminThe New York Times How the Head of a … WebThe organization’s founder lacks nonprofit experience. For newer organizations, the founder might have admirable aspirations but lack the expertise to make those goals a reality. An executive director with nonprofit experience can help your organization execute decisions, raise crucial funds, and develop achievable ideas.
